    How does this rum taste?

    The Jamaican Rum <>H from Hampden distillery, bottled by Corman Collins, is a high-proof rum aged 16 years in Jamaica. Its aroma offers a powerful blend of fruity esters with hints of nail polish, and the taste is dominated by ripe banana and pineapple, followed by notes of glue and woody undertones. Users have praised its complexity and long finish, marked by spices and leather. However, some noted it lacked a certain sweetness and delicacy typically appreciated in similar high-ester rums. This rum stands out for those who appreciate bold, distinctive flavors, typical of Hampden's production.

    Clearly Hampden and yet atypical! While the rum does not disguise its origin at all and clearly screams "Hampden" with distinct glue and burnt pineapple aromas, it surprises above all with strong spicy notes. The comparatively faint nose is reminiscent of gingerbread (stomach bread from the fairground stall!) and then floods the palate with baking spices and bitter, woody notes that linger long, leaving a dry mouthfeel reminiscent of coffee grounds. Those who can taste it should do so. Exciting!

    👃: 1er nez très pâtissier façon baba au rhum. 10 mins après l'avoir servi le nez évolue : légères notes de colle, solvant, la banane flambée et l'ananas rôti cohabitent avec l'olive verte façon tapenade. Légère note de poivre et de caramel brûlé 👄 : le poivre titille les papilles accompagné d'une note de bois humide puis le solvant apparaît brièvement pour laisser place aux fruits maturés avec des notes flambées et toastées. Ensuite pendant quelques secondes la bouche est anesthésiée puis le poivre réapparaît et s'éclipse très progressivement pour laisser place a l'olive verte et enfin la cassonade en finale. La longueur est dans la moyenne haute. En résumé il se passe beaucoup de choses lorsque l'on déguste ce Corman Collins. Un excellent Hampden, pas le + structuré mais complexe
